Ticket raised by the Calverro operations team for a data-centre cage visit at the Northbridge facility, Hall B, Cage 12. Team assistants should book the visit at least 48 hours ahead, list all attendees, and confirm escort availability with the duty engineer. Attendees must bring photo ID and leave all drinks outside the hall. Photography inside the cage is prohibited. The mantrap into Hall B requires the escort's badge plus the cage pass below.

turnstile pass: bdg-NG-3

Subject: Partner SFTP drop — new owner

Hi,

As you review the pending changes to the Harborline ingest scripts, note that ownership of the partner SFTP drop is changing at the end of the month. This includes key rotation, the nightly pull job, and the quarantine folder for malformed files. Review comments on the retry logic should still go through the normal PR flow, but questions about drop-folder conventions or partner onboarding now go to the new owner. The incoming owner is listed below.

signatory, tagaf-bahaf: Praael Fenmir Rusok

## Deployment

ReceiptWren, our donation-receipt mailer, deploys from the `stable` branch via the Quillgate pipeline. Before promoting a build, confirm the template bundle version matches what the Harbrook finance team signed off on, since receipts are legally sensitive. Run the dry-run mailer against the sandbox donor list and inspect at least three rendered PDFs. Rollbacks must restore both the binary and the template bundle together; mismatched pairs produce blank totals. The environment expects the following configuration values at startup.

settings of tawif-tafog:
[oliox]
port = 7000
team = pelius
host = oliox.plorvaforge.corp
region = upper-2
access_code = ac_48b9f0
timeout_ms = 3000